After another week of split results against Penn State and Illinois, the Wisconsin Badgers continued to fall to No. 21 in the latest Ferris Mowers Coaches Poll powered by USA TODAY Sports.

Although the Badgers looked dominant in their game against the Penn State Nittany Lions, Wisconsin could not find any answers for the scoring of Kofi Cockburn and Ayo Dosumnu against the Fighting Illini losing by 15 points. It will be important for Wisconsin to play well on Thursday against Nebraska, before playing No. 3 Michigan at the Kohl Center on Feb. 14.

The Big Ten stated its dominance in the latest Ferris Mowers Coaches Poll with three teams included in the top 10. Michigan, Ohio State and Illinois have all moved up this week to No. 3, No. 5 and No. 10, while Iowa has continued their plummet from the top 10 to No. 16. Purdue also makes an appearance in the latest poll at No. 25, because of their upset victory against Minnesota last week.

The top 10 for this week includes Gonzaga (1), Baylor (2), Michigan (3), Villanova (4), Ohio State (5), Illinois (6), Houston (7), Texas Tech (8), Virginia (9) and Missouri (10).

Wisconsin will face the Nebraska Cornhuskers(4-9) next in Lincoln, Neb. on Thursday at 4:00 p.m. CST.
